Abstract:
The paper demonstrates the fundamental possibility of forming carbon structures in polyvinyl chloride (PVC) films without additives and in PVC films added with 5 wt. % of ferrocene. Radiation-chemical transformations was realized in air on a repetitive pulsed plasma cathode electron accelerator at a maximum electron energy of no more than 160 keV, pulse duration of 40 ms, and current density of 5 mA/cm2. Semi-quantitative X-ray microanalysis shows that the irradiated PVC film free of additives contains 92 wt. % of carbon, 6 wt. % of oxygen, and 2 wt. % of chlorine, representing an amorphous carbon material. Possible mechanisms of the observed phenomenon are discussed.
